What are 3D animators?

3D animators are professionals who create moving images in a three-dimensional digital environment. They use specialized software to develop characters, objects, and scenes that appear to move and interact in a realistic or stylized way. 3D animators work in industries such as film, video games, television, advertising, and virtual reality, bringing stories and concepts to life through animation techniques.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in 3D modeling roles,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in 3D modeling often encounter challenges such as managing complex software tools, meeting tight project deadlines, and ensuring models meet both technical and artistic requirements. Collaboration with designers, engineers, or animators can also present communication hurdles, especially when translating creative concepts into precise digital models. Staying updated with rapidly evolving software and techniques is crucial, so many 3D modelers participate in ongoing training or peer learning sessions. Building strong communication skills and adopting efficient workflow practices can help overcome these obstacles and contribute to career growth in the field.

Job description

Hydraulics International, Inc (HII) seeks a Technician III responsible for performing a variety of tasks related to the assembly, installation, maintenance, and repair of mechanical and electrical equipment within a manufacturing environment. The ideal candidate will have prior experience working with hand tools and mechanical systems, as well as a strong understanding of safety procedures and protocols. You should be a reliable person and team player.

Key Performance Deliverables:

  • Assemble, install, maintain, and repair mechanical and electrical equipment within a manufacturing environment
  • Use hand tools and mechanical equipment to complete tasks efficiently and effectively
  • Follow all safety procedures and protocols to ensure a safe work environment
  • Diagnose and troubleshoot issues with mechanical and electrical equipment
  • Collaborate with team members and management to complete tasks and resolve issues in a timely manner
  • Document work completed and maintain accurate records of maintenance and repair activities

Requirements:

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• 1+ years of experience working with hand tools and mechanical systems in a manufacturing setting
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to diagnose and troubleshoot issues with mechanical and electrical equipment
  • Knowledge of safety procedures and protocols
  • Ability to work independently and in a team environment
  • Good communication skills and attention to detail

Salary Expectations:

$18.00HR - $19 HR. DOE

About HII:

HII headquartered in Chatsworth, California, U.S.A., is a leading supplier of integrated products, services and support to military forces, aviation and commercial industries, Government agencies and prime contractors worldwide. Focused on defense and commercial technology, the Company develops manufactures and supports a broad range of systems for over one hundred industries as well as mission critical and military sustainment requirements worldwide. We are extremely proud of the fact that our extensive design capabilities enable us to produce the most sophisticated units known to today's technology.

Our corporate, engineering and manufacturing facilities, located in Chatsworth, CA and Forsyth, GA, encompass over 625,000 sq. feet. Our manufacturing facility is equipped with the latest state-of-the-art equipment such as CNC lathes and mills, computerized tube bending, and automatic press brake and programmable punch press, laser topography scanners, and other quality verification devices.
